3men2s Posted June 3, 2011 Author Share Posted June 3, 2011 (edited) After checking what I have I came up with this combo. 1981, MUSTANGS. THE RACE VERSION WAS FORDS COME BACK TO PRO RACING IN THE US IN THE IMSA CIRCUIT. THEY RACED IN EUROPE WITH THE ZAKSPEED CAPRIS, AND WERE DOMINATING. THE MUSTANG RACED HARD WITH KLAUS LUDWIG IN THE WHEEL. THE 4 CIL TURBO GAVE THE 935 PORSCHE A HAND FULL AT THE TRACK. THE ROAD VERSION WAS ALRIGHT, NOT AS MUCH HP UNTIL THEY BEAFED UP THE 5.0 IN 85. THE ENGINE ON THE ROAD VERSION CAME IN TWO OPTIONS, 4 CIL TURBO, "PINTO ENGINE" OR THE V8.....IF I GO WITH THE 4 CILINDER ON THIS BUILD..WILL PUT HEADERS, INTERCOOLER AND A BIGGER TURBO.
